How Standing Water Extraction Actually Works
Our process begins with a thorough assessment. This is where we identify the source and extent of the water damage.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and find out the best course of action. Accuracy is key to a successful restoration.
Step 1: Extraction and Removal
We’ll extract the standing water using specialized pumps.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age. Our technicians are trained to handle even the toughest situations. Within 60 minutes, we’ll have the water removed and your property on the road to recovery.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ll set up drying equipment to evaporate remaining moisture. This is a critical step in preventing mold growth and further damage. Our technicians monitor the drying process closely. We’ll work tirelessly to ensure your property is dry and safe.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ect all affected areas. This is essential in removing any remaining bacteria or contaminants. Our sanitizing process is designed to prevent future issues. You can trust our team to leave your property spotless.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Finally, we’ll repair and restore any damaged areas. This may include replacing drywall, flooring, or other affected materials. Our goal is to make it look like nothing ever happened. We’ll work with you to ensure a seamless transition back to normal.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ction
Catching these signs early can save you thousands. Don’t ignore musty odors, warping wood, or peeling paint. These are red flags for standing water dam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ors are a sign of moisture buildup. This can lead to mold growth and serious health risks. Don’t wait, address the issue quickly.
Warping Wood or Peeling Paint
These visual signs show water damage. This can compromise the structural integrity of your property. Act fast to prevent further damage.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Visible stains or discoloration show water damage. This can lead to costly repairs and replacements. Don’t delay, contact us today.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ring is a clear sign of water damage. This can compromise the safety and integrity of your property. Address the issue quickly.
Cracked or Broken Foundations
Cracked or broken foundations show serious water damage. This can lead to costly repairs and potentially threaten the stability of your property. Don’t wait, contact us now.

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Josephine, TX
Prices vary based on severity, size of aff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s in Josephine, TX. Your actual cost may be higher or lower.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of drying equipment, and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products, and level of sanitizing required |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ials and labor required, and complexity of repairs |
